TPWallet是一款多功能的数字资产管理钱包,支持多种区块链的资产管理和合约交互。了解TPWallet的合约类型对于用户安全地管理和使用其数字资产至关重要。本文将详细介绍如何查看TPWallet的合约类型,以及这些合约类型的意义和影响。我们还将探讨一些相关问题,以加深读者对TPWallet及其合约类型的理解。
在深入探讨TPWallet的合约类型之前,我们首先来了解一下TPWallet和区块链合约的基本概念。
TPWallet是一个去中心化的钱包,支持多种区块链网络,用户可以在其上管理不同类型的加密货币。此外,TPWallet提供了对智能合约的支持,使用户能够与去中心化应用(DApps)进行交互。
合约类型通常包括标准合约、增值合约和其他自定义合约。每种合约类型都有其独特的功能和用途。理解这些合约类型将帮助用户更好地使用TPWallet及其与区块链的交互功能。
在TPWallet上查看合约类型,可以通过以下几种方式进行:
首先,用户需要打开TPWallet应用程序并登录到自己的账户。用户可以通过手机应用商店下载TPWallet,或者直接访问官网进行网页版操作。
在主界面中,用户通常会找到一个专门用于合约管理的选项,可能被标记为“合约”、“智能合约”或“DApp”。用户应该点击这个选项。
在合约管理界面,用户将看到一系列可用的合约类型,通常分为标准合约、增值合约以及其他类型,用户可以根据需要选择查看。
点击每个合约类型,用户将能查看详细信息,包括合约的功能、使用限制和风险等。这些信息能够帮助用户判断合约是否符合他们的需求。
TPWallet中合约类型的分类主要包括:
标准合约是最常见的合约类型,通常符合某种协议,如ERC-20、ERC-721等。这些合约有助于创建标准化的代币,确保在不同平台之间的兼容性。
增值合约一般是指那些在标准合约的基础上增加了附加功能或服务的合约。例如,这些合约可能支持股权分红、投票权或其他形式的收益。
自定义合约则是根据特定需求设计的合约,通常适用于项目开发者或企业。由于这些合约的灵活性,功能和使用场景的多样性使其面临的风险也相对较高。
在TPWallet中选择合适的合约类型是确保安全和效率的关键步骤。以下是一些建议:
在选择合约之前,需要明确自己的需求是什么。是进行代币交易、参与权益分配,还是需要更复杂的功能?了解需求是选择合约的第一步。
不同合约提供的功能各异,因此在选择之前,用户应研究每种合约的功能,并评估它们是否符合自己的需求。
合约类型往往伴随着不同的风险,用户应当清楚了解这些合约的风险,并在可以承担的范围内进行选择。
以下是围绕TPWallet合约类型的五个可能相关问题,逐个展开详细介绍。
TPWallet安全性的保障是用户关注的重点。TPWallet采取了多种措施来确保用户合约的安全性:
多重签名技术:TPWallet支持多重签名技术,这意味着在执行某些关键操作时,需要多个签名才能完成。这项技术能够有效降低因私钥泄露而导致的资金损失风险。
合约审计:许多TPWallet支持的合约在上线之前都会经过专业的第三方审计,确保它们的代码没有漏洞或后门,大大降低了安全风险。
实时监控:TPWallet还提供了实时的监控系统,可以及时发现异常行为并向用户发送警报,提醒用户注意保护资产安全。
综上所述,TPWallet在保障用户合约安全性方面采取了多种有效措施。
交易费用是尤其在使用合约类型时必须考虑的因素。TPWallet的交易费用通常包括:
网络费用:在区块链操作中,用户需要支付一定的网络费用,具体费用取决于当前网络的繁忙程度和合约类型。
合约执行费用:某些合约在执行时可能会要求额外的费用,特别是在执行复杂的逻辑时。这种费用通常由合约的开发者设定,并会在用户发起交易时提前展示。
手续费:此外,TPWallet可能还会对某些服务收取手续费,用户在使用合约类型前,应仔细查看相关费用。
创建自定义合约通常需要一定程度的编程知识。在TPWallet上创建自定义合约的步骤如下:
选择编程语言:用户需要选择适合的编程语言,常用的有Solidity、Vyper等。在区域选择编程语言后,用户将能够编写合约代码。
编写合约代码:在完成前期的准备工作后,用户会进入代码编写阶段。在这一阶段,用户需要根据自己的需求完成合约逻辑的编写,确保其符合预期功能。
测试合约:在合约代码完成后,用户需进行测试,使用测试网对合约进行多轮调试,以确保没有错误发生。
部署合约:合约调试完成,用户可以将其部署到主网上,TPWallet通常会提供简便的部署工具,帮助用户完成这一步骤。
TPWallet支持多种公链合约,主要包括:
以太坊(Ethereum):以太坊是最著名的智能合约平台,使用广泛的ERC-20和ERC-721标准都在TPWallet中得到了良好的支持。
波场(Tron):TPWallet也支持波场的TRC-10和TRC-20合约,用户可以方便地在平台上管理这些标准的代币。
EOS: TPWallet支持EOS平台的智能合约功能,用户可以直接与DApp进行交互。
除此之外,TPWallet可能还会不断扩展对其他公链的支持。因此,用户应定期查看TPWallet的官方更新,以了解最新的合约功能。
在使用TPWallet上的合约时,用户可能会遇到以下常见
交易卡顿:用户在使用合约时,有可能会由于网络繁忙导致交易卡顿。建议用户记录下其交易的哈希,并留意区块链的实时信息,以便确认状态。
合约执行失败:如果合约执行失败,通常可能由于合约参数设置不正确或合约本身存在问题。用户应仔细检查输入的所有参数,并在需要时咨询相关的文档或技术支持。
安全用户在与合约交互过程中,应时刻保持警觉,以防止受到恶意合约的攻击。在选择合约时,尽量选择经过审计或有较好评价的合约。
以上是关于在TPWallet上使用合约时常见的一些问题及其解决方案,用户可根据具体情况进行调整和解决。
总的来说,深入了解TPWallet的合约类型和使用技巧,可以帮助用户更好地管理数字资产,提高资产的安全性和流动性。希望本文对您理解TPWallet提供的合约类型有所帮助。